Adding the Statement of Cashflows settings screen and improved formatting on KPI reports.

New: Cashflow Statement Settings

The Statement of Cashflow settings screen is where you can go to classify accounts as Operating, Financing, Investing or non-cash for the purpose of presenting a Statement of Cashflows report. Please see the Cashflow Statement help note for more details.

Improved: KPI Conditional Formatting on Reports

With the recent introduction of Higher or Lower is Better setting, we coloured KPI variances as red to indicate an unfavourable result. We've now extended this to the KPI values and not just the variances. So now if KPIs return an unfavourable result, it will also be formatted with red text. This means KPIs and the accounts section of reports are consistent and any unfavourable value is shown in red text.
